De min() er en metode av Integer-klassen under java.lang-pakken . Denne metoden returnerer numerisk minimumsverdien blant de to metodene argument spesifisert av en bruker. Denne metoden kan bli overbelastet og den tar argumentene i int, double , float og long.
Merk: Hvis et positivt og et negativt tall sendes som et argument, genererte det det negative resultatet. Og hvis begge parameterne passerte som et negativt tall, genererer det et resultat med større størrelse.
Syntaks:
Følgende er erklæringen fra min() metode:
nettverkstopologier
public static int min(int a, int b) public static long min(long a, long b) public static float min(float a, float b) public static double min(double a, double b)
Parameter:
Data-type | Parameter | Beskrivelse | Påkrevd/Valgfri |
---|---|---|---|
int | en | Numerisk verdi angitt av en bruker. | Obligatorisk |
int | b | Numerisk verdi angitt av en bruker. | Obligatorisk |
Returnerer:
De min() metoden returnerer den minste verdien blant argumentet med to metoder spesifisert av en bruker.
Unntak:
AT
Kompatibilitetsversjon:
Java 1.5 og nyere
Eksempel 1
public class IntegerMinExample1 { public static void main(String[] args) { // Get two integer numbers int a = 5485; int b = 3242; // print the smaller number between x and y System.out.println('Math.min(' + a + ',' + b + ')=' + Math.min(a, b)); } }Test det nå
Produksjon:
Math.min(5485,3242)=3242
Eksempel 2
import java.util.Scanner; public class IntegerMinExample2 { public static void main(String[] args) { //Get two integer numbers from console System.out.println('Enter the Two Numeric value: '); Scanner readInput= new Scanner(System.in); int a = readInput.nextInt(); int b = readInput.nextInt(); readInput.close(); //Print the smaller number between a and b System.out.println('Smaller value of Math.min(' + a + ',' + b + ') = ' + Math.min(a, b)); } }
Produksjon:
Enter the Two Numeric value: 45 76 Smaller value of Math.min(45,76) = 45
Eksempel 3
public class IntegerMinExample3 { public static void main(String[] args) { //Get two integer numbers int a = -70; int b = -25; // prints result with greater magnitude System.out.println('Result: '+Math.min(a, b)); } }Test det nå
Produksjon:
Result: -70
Eksempel 4
public class IntegerMinExample4 { public static void main(String[] args) { //Get two integer numbers int a = -20; int b = 25; // prints result with negative value System.out.println('Result: '+Math.min(a, b)); }Test det nå
Produksjon:
Result: -20